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team arrives on-site to assess the damage and develop a customized plan for extraction. We use specialized equipment to identify the source of the leak and the extent of the damage.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a clear estimate of the costs involved.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, using specialized equipment to prevent further damage. Our technicians are trained to handle even the toughest water extraction jobs, ensuring a thorough and effective process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. We use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to remove moisture and prevent mold growth.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ure the area is completely dry and safe for occupancy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Finally, our team will cl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We use eco-friendly cleaning products and specialized equipment to ensure a thorough and effective cleaning process.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Extraction
Water damage can be sneaky, but there are often warning signs that show you need Commercial Water Extraction.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Look out for the following war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ell can show water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and health risks.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can show water damage or excessive moisture.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Unexplained Mold Growth
Unexplained mold growth can show excessive moisture or water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and health risks.
Water-Related Equipment Failure
Water-related equipment failure can show a larger issue with your commercial property.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Unusual Noises or Leaks
Unusual noises or leaks can show a water-related issue.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Common Questions About Commercial Water Extraction
Q: What causes water damage in commercial properties?
A: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, clogged drains, storms, and equipment failure.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a customized solution.
Q: How long does Commercial Water Extraction take?
A: The length of time required for Commercial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work efficiently to complete the extraction process as quickly as possible.
Q: Is Commercial Water Extraction covered by insurance?
A: Yes, Commercial Water Extraction may be covered by insurance, depending on the cause of the damage and the terms of your policy. Our team can help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.
Q: Can I prevent water damage in my commercial property?
A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age in your commercial property, including regular maintenance, inspections, and repairs. Our team can provide you with guidance on how to prevent water damage and ensure the longevity of your property.
